List of Samsung Mobile Service Centers & Showroom in Nepal

Samsung mobile phones are available to approximately 30 million people in Nepal. It covers all 7 provinces, 14 zones, and 77 Districts of the country. Integrated Mobility Solutions Pvt. Ltd., in short IMS, has been the authorized distributor of Samsung Mobiles in Nepal since 2001. However, Him Electronics Pvt. Ltd, has been selected as Samsung’s second distributor for mobile phones in Nepal since 2016. Both these distributors have their separate service centers and experience stores and showrooms.

Samsung Mobile has all kinds of phones with different features as per your needs and even more. A wide range of economic or budget-friendly smartphones, as well as high-end smartphones, makes Samsung the leading brand.

Samsung IMS Smart cafe and HIM electronics outlets are brick-and-mortar stores one can touch and feel the products, play with them and then you can easily decide which model is suitable for you. Similarly, both IMS Care and HIM Service have been contributing excellent after-sales services with their dedicated service centers.

Samsung Nepal Free Pickup and Drop Service for Warranty

Samsung Nepal has also started a free pickup and drop-off service for warranty service. That means if you have some issues with your Samsung phone that is under the warranty period, you can just call them for the free service. For that, you can dial NTC’s toll-free number 16600172667, or Ncell number 9801572667. Or else, you can also WhatsApp to this number 16600172667.

A Samsung representative will come to pick your phone up at your desired location/address. And then, after the repair, your phone will be delivered to the same place. Currently, the service is live across Kathmandu Valley through service centers located at New Road, Sundhara, Jawalakhel, New Baneshwor, and Bhaktapur.

Samsung Mobile Warranty Rules & Regulations in Nepal

First and foremost, if you have bought a Samsung phone from abroad, you are not eligible for a warranty. And your phone will be allowed for repair. That’s one of the few perks of buying your Samsung phone via an authorized distributor in Nepal.

Samsung offers one year of Software warranty and six months on battery for every model they sell here in Nepal. Moreover, Samsung is offering breakage insurance on its high-end models like the Galaxy S23 series.

Also, while visiting a Samsung service center for repair, make sure you carry your warranty card, VAT bill, and Government ID proof.

Moondrop Rays Gaming wired ‘earbuds’ launched with USB-C and hybrid drivers

0

Moondrop has released its latest gaming-focused wired earbuds, the Moondrop Rays. The product features USB-C support, ultra-low latency, and a hybrid driver system. It is also compatible with in-app EQ settings tailored for popular competitive games. This article will discuss everything about the latest Moondrop Rays Gaming Earbuds, including its expected price in Nepal, specifications, and availability.

Moondrop Rays Gaming Earbuds Overview

USB-C connection

moondrop ray gaming earbuds price in nepal

One of the striking features of the Moondrop Rays Gaming earbuds is that they feature a wired USB-C connection. Although this is not a new thing, many smartphone companies have slowly removed the 3.5mm headphone jack from their smartphones, audio companies have shifted towards a type-C connection instead. As a result, it does not include any 3.5mm or 4.4mm jack. The earbuds support latency under 5ms. Compared to typical wireless earbuds, which have around 50ms, this is significantly lower.

Audio driver setup

It uses a hybrid system combining dynamic and planar magnetic drivers. The frequency response ranges from 7Hz to 39kHz. The default sound is neutral and users can adjust EQ through the Moondrop app. The app includes preset profiles for more than 20 games like Valorant, Apex Legends, and CS:GO. In addition, users can create and share custom profiles.

Built-in DAC and cable features

It comes with a built-in DAC that supports up to 32-bit / 384kHz. Furthermore, the cable includes a mic and remote for in-game chat. The body is made from 3D-printed resin and is designed to be ergonomic. Additionally, the box includes a USB-A to USB-C extension cable for PC compatibility.

Acer Aspire 16 launched in Nepal with Intel Core 7 CPU and RTX 2050

0

Acer’s Aspire Series is designed for everyday use by students, home users, and office workers. Under this very brand, we have a new Acer Aspire 16 laptop in Nepal with a Core 7 150U processor and RTX 2050 graphics card. In this article, we’ll walk through the specs, features, and price of the Acer Aspire 16 2024 in Nepal.

Acer Aspire 16 2024 Overview

Design and Display

Commencing with the design, the Apsire 16 (2024) boasts an identical look to what we have seen on the Apsire laptops. It boasts a big 16-inch display as the name implies, and this IPS panel boasts a WUXGA resolution (1920 x 1200 pixels) with a static 60Hz refresh rate. Likewise, it has an aspect ratio of 16:10 and covers 45% of the NTSC color gamut, suitable for general productivity tasks and media consumption.

Acer Aspire 16 2024 Design and Display

Performance

Under the hood, Acer has packed a Core 7 150U processor from Intel with a base clock speed of 1.80GHz and 5.4GHz of max turbo frequency. It is contemplated by an RTX 2050 GPU with 4GB VRAM. This entry-level graphics card can handle light to moderate gaming. Medium to High settings with decent FPS on games like Vlaornat, CS2, and Fortnite. Memory-wise, you get 16GB of RAM paired with 512GB of PCIe NVMe Gen4 SSD. Moreover, the laptop boots on Windows 11 Home software.

Acer Aspire 5 2024 work

Battery, Ports, and Others

Moving on, the laptop gets its fuel from a 50Wh 3-cell Li-ion battery which supports 65W charging. I/O ports here include 1x USB Thunderbolt 4 Type-C port, 2x USB 3.2 Gen 1 Type-A port, 1x HDMI 2.1 port, and 1x 3.5mm headphone jack. Furthermore, it boasts WiFi 6E and Bluetooth 5.1 for wireless connectivity.

How to buy laptops under NPR 50,000 in Nepal? [Mini-Guide]

With a budget of around NPR 50000, it’s hard to get laptops with an Intel Core processor in Nepal. So, if you spot one, get it right away.

Just a year ago, you had to end up with lower-end processors like Celeron processors. Now, you can find at least Intel Core i3 and AMD Ryzen 3 processors in this price range, offering a much more significant performance boost than the Celeron processors. You should also easily get 4GB (or even 8GB) of RAM and 256GB of SSD in this price range.

Bigger displays might be tempting, but a smaller screen with a similar resolution will yield better pixel density and clarity. Also, always get your laptops from reliable sellers even if they charge a little extra as they provide better after-sales service.

JBL Tune Flex 2 earbuds now available in Nepal

0

JBL has introduced the Tune Flex 2, a pair of true wireless earbuds featuring adaptive noise cancelling and Bluetooth 5.3.  This article will discuss everything about the latest JBL Tune Flex 2, including its price in Nepal, specifications, and availability.

JBL Tune Flex 2 Overview

Design and features

The JBL Tune Flex 2 comes with a 12 mm dynamic driver, offering a frequency range of 20 Hz to 20 kHz. The earbuds have an IP54 water resistance rating and feature Adaptive Noise Cancelling (ANC) and Ambient Aware, adjusting audio based on surroundings. Additionally, they include JBL Pure Bass sound and a touch-control interface.

JBL Tune Flex 2 designa

Connectivity

The earbuds are equipped with Bluetooth 5.3, supporting profiles such as A2DP V1.4, AVRCP V1.6.2, and HFP V1.8. Their Bluetooth range spans from 2.4 GHz to 2.4835 GHz.

Battery life

The earbuds are powered by a 55mAh lithium-ion battery, offering up to 12 hours of playtime with ANC off and up to 8 hours with ANC on. The talk time lasts up to 5 hours without ANC and 4.5 hours with ANC. The earbuds charge fully in about 2 hours.

Additional features

The JBL Tune Flex 2 also supports multi-point connections, TalkThru, Voice Aware, and spatial sound. The earbuds are compatible with the JBL Headphone App.

Kathmandu Metropolitan City rolls out an initiative to microchip pets

Kathmandu Metropolitan City (KMC) has rolled out a pet microchipping initiative, advising pet sellers to microchip dogs and cats before sale. This information was recently published on their Facebook page, along with instructions for pet owners to register their microchipped pets at their local ward office.

A microchip, which is usually implanted in the animal’s neck, stores important information such as the owner’s name, the pet’s age, and its health history. This data can be scanned using an electronic reader, helping authorities maintain better records of domestic animals within the city.

According to Nuranidhi Neupane, head of KMC’s Agriculture and Livestock Department, the regulation is part of a broader effort to simplify pet registration and improve animal monitoring. While also supporting efforts to manage local and street dogs more effectively.

Implementation in progress, but still in early stages

After asking the KMC office for more details, I found that the program also aims to take care of and manage street and local dogs more effectively. Once the system is in place completely, pet owners will need to have their pets microchipped at a veterinary clinic and provide certain documents to their respective ward office for registration.

Officials, however, clarified that the system is still in its early stages. They are encouraging the public to get used to the system, but at a gradual pace. They have already begun data collection exercises, and in the future, all pet-related records will be stored in a central database. A new web portal will also be launched to provide notifications regarding any pets. Including updates on registration and other relevant information.

Also Read:

Encouraging responsible pet ownership

Mr. Neupane emphasized that this regulation is part of KMC’s broader goal of promoting responsible pet ownership. With microchips providing a permanent ID for each animal, the hope is that the abandonment rates and traceability of pets improve in Kathmandu City.

Moto G Stylus is refreshed for the year 2025 with Snapdragon Gen 3

0

Motorola has officially unveiled the Moto G Stylus (2025), an updated edition of its well-established mid-range device. The new Moto G Stylus comes with improved features, including a large AMOLED display, enhanced cameras, and fast charging capabilities. This article will discuss everything about the latest Moto G Stylus, including its expected price in Nepal, specifications, and availability.

Moto G Stylus (2025) Overview

Display and Build

 Moto G Stylus (2025) Design and Display

The Moto G Stylus (2025) sports a 6.7-inch AMOLED display with a 120Hz refresh rate, offering smoother visuals. The screen has a peak brightness of 3000 nits with resolutions of  1220 x 2712 pixels. The device is built with a glass front protected by Gorilla Glass 3, a silicone polymer (eco-leather) back, and a plastic frame.

Camera Setup

The main camera setup features a 50 MP wide sensor and a 13 MP ultrawide sensor. The 50 MP primary camera uses the Sony Lytia LYT-700C sensor, supports Optical Image Stabilization (OIS), and can record videos in 4K at 30fps. The 13 MP ultrawide camera comes with macro capabilities. The front-facing camera is a 32 MP sensor that also supports 4K video recording at 30fps.

Performance and Battery

Under the hood, the Moto G Stylus (2025) is powered by the Qualcomm Snapdragon 6 Gen 3 chipset, featuring an octa-core CPU with 4x 2.4 GHz Cortex-A78 and 4x 1.8 GHz Cortex-A55 cores. It is paired with 8GB of RAM and up to 256GB of internal storage, which is expandable via a microSD card. The 5000 mAh battery ensures long-lasting usage and supports 68W wired charging as well as 15W wireless charging.

Durability and Other Features

The Moto G Stylus (2025) is IP68 certified, meaning it is resistant to dust and water (immersible up to 1.5m for 30 minutes). It is also MIL-STD-810H compliant and the phone comes with stereo speakers supported by Dolby Atmos for better sound, NFC, and a fingerprint sensor located under the display for security.
